Output 2e21f3172239b5cfecca71f1ca9c464b0ae4500f18833f5612dc057624b2bb59:1

value
673514
script pubkey
OP_0 OP_PUSHBYTES_20 2bc1a88806490ec0b33ddbb911e7d3ee02827c38
address
bc1q90q63zqxfy8vpveamwu3re7nacpgylpc36efmq
transaction
2e21f3172239b5cfecca71f1ca9c464b0ae4500f18833f5612dc057624b2bb59
confirmations
321019
spent
true